How they compare
Sao Tome and Principe currently reports 1.1 against 0.9199 in Croatia, a difference of 0.1801.
That makes Sao Tome and Principe's figure about 1.2 times Croatia's.
Across all 5 years both countries report, Sao Tome and Principe has been ahead every year.
Croatia ranks 127th and Sao Tome and Principe ranks 123rd of 160 countries.
Sao Tome and Principe has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
